R. C. Bill is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Mechanics of Materials and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, R. C. Bill has authored 56 papers receiving a total of 521 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 43 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 32 papers in Mechanics of Materials and 21 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in R. C. Bill's work include Tribology and Lubrication Engineering (20 papers), Mechanical stress and fatigue analysis (16 papers) and Metal Alloys Wear and Properties (14 papers). R. C. Bill is often cited by papers focused on Tribology and Lubrication Engineering (20 papers), Mechanical stress and fatigue analysis (16 papers) and Metal Alloys Wear and Properties (14 papers). R. C. Bill collaborates with scholars based in United States, Türkiye and Thailand. R. C. Bill's co-authors include Robert L. Johnson, Edward C. Smith, Edward C. Smith, Robert C. Hendricks, Hans DeSmidt, Thomas A. Griffin, Tanmay Mathur, Kon‐Well Wang, Robert F. Handschuh and G. R. Halford and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Materials Science, Thin Solid Films and Wear.
